Roadrunners drop Sunday match to Wichita State

by Kaden Chumbley

SAN ANTONIO — UTSA dropped a 4-2 decision to Wichita State on Sunday afternoon at the UTSA Tennis Center.

The Roadrunners (3-5) claimed an early lead after securing the doubles point. Miguel Alonso and Santiago Flyckt paired up for a 6-2 victory at No. 3 before Oskar Grzegorzewski and Ben Chetewy Ungar clinched the 1-0 advantage with a 6-4 decision at the top of the lineup.

In singles, Enzo Vargas pushed UTSA’s lead to 2-0 with a quick 6-1, 6-3 triumph over Zaid Al Mashni at No. 6.

The Shockers (4-5) got on the board when Amir Milushev scored a 6-2, 6-2 sweep of Flyckt on court five.

WSU then knotted things at 2-all with a 7-5, 6-3 victory by Vanja Hodzic over Ungar at No. 3.

The visitors took a 3-2 lead after Ilias Worthington edged Alonso at No. 4, 6-4, 7-6 (8) before clinching the match at No. 2, as Alejandro Jacome outlasted Danijal Muminovic in three sets, 5-7, 6-3, 6-1.
